What each input means

Load Weight
Actual weight of the harvested load from scale or weigh wagon.
Header Width
Combine header cutting width.
Pass Distance
Length of the calibration pass (half mile = 2640 ft).
Actual Grain Moisture
Moisture content of grain as harvested.
Standard Moisture
Market standard moisture (corn 15.5%, soybeans 13%, wheat 13.5%).
